The general gaming populace won't, but graffiti writers will.

Getting up is throwing your name UP around town, in multiple places. The more up you are, the more respect you get, and the more kiddies wanna bite your style. It can also stand for "Under Pressure", as in, the more you write, the more the cops are out to get you.
